Circuit/System Verification

  1. Ignition ON.
  2. Verify the scan tool Brake Pedal Applied parameter changes between Active and Inactive while pressing and releasing the brake pedal.
    • Go to next step: If the parameter changes 
  3. Verify the scan tool Brake Pedal Position Sensor Learned Release Position parameter, located in the BCM Chassis Control Data display, is within 0.1 V of the Brake Pedal Position Sensor parameter when the brake pedal is fully released.
    • Go to next step: If the difference is less than 0.1 V 
  4. Verify the left brake lamp turns ON and OFF when commanding the Left Stop Lamp ON and OFF with a scan tool.
    • Go to next step: If the left brake lamp turns ON and OFF 
  5. Verify the right brake lamp turns ON and OFF when commanding the Right Stop Lamp ON and OFF with a scan tool.
    • Go to next step: If the right brake lamp turns ON and OFF 
  6. Verify the center high mounted stop lamp turns ON and OFF when commanding the Center Stop Lamp ON and OFF with a scan tool.
    • Go to next step: If the center high mounted stop turns ON and OFF 
  7. All OK.
